Mamawee for Model Number WTW6200SW2 The washer makes a LOUD noise when spinning and goes out of balance unless it is a tiny load. Towels and jeans are impossible... Is it a bearing issue? If so, what part(s) do I need?
Answer Mamawee, The loud noise in the spin cycle would indicate a tub bearing issue. Because of the "drag" created by the worn bearings, it could also explain the "UL" and "DC" error codes in the display. At present you have the option of replacing the outer tub assembly W10193886 which will have the bearings, seal and shaft included. Your other option is to order the Bearing and Seal kit W10435302 and the tool W10447783 to remove and install the bearings in the original outer tub. Read More...
